Installs and configure ISC DHCP server
Current server IP Address
Synchronisation peer Address
URL to use in the bootmenu entries
DEPRECATED
Hash describing `::iscdhcp::include` resources to create
Default value for `dhcp_config` parameter of `includes`
List of packages to install
Target state for `packages`, `present` or `latest` (default: `present`)
Path of the main configuration file (default: '/etc/dhcp/dhcpd.conf')
Array of options set globally in the main configuration file.
Hash describing options for the shared net
Path of the file giving default environment for the service (sysconfig or default).
Content of `default_file` as an array of lines.
Service Name
Target state for the service (default: '')
Systemd unit file path for the service
Systemd unit file content for the service, this parameter is not merged with the default.
iscdhcp::config, iscdhcp::install, iscdhcp::service